Possible Solutions:
---------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------
In the console, type the following:
ToggleEmotions

(Special Thanks to Headless Chickens Inc)
---------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------
In the console, type the following:
ToggleEmotions

In the .ini file change the following
"iFPSClamp=0" to "iFPSClamp=40"
(Special Thanks to Neversleeps)
---------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------
A clean install of the drivers using Driver Sweeper.
(Special Thanks to iamMark)
---------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------
In the .ini file change the following:
"bUseFaceGenHeads=1" to "bUseFaceGenHeads=0"
This Solution will cut off everyone's head.
(Special Thanks to Diari)

I haven't tried this yet, but will this cause my game to run in dx9?

Yes. That is exactly what it does. But New Vegas doesn't have any DX10 or DX11 features, so you won't notice any difference in graphics. Except hopefully a cure for your framerate issues!
